PIC12 Serisi Mikrodenetleyici İle Zamanlayıcı Projeleri
PIC12 Serisi Mikrodenetleyici İle Zamanlayıcı Projeleri
PIC12 serisi mikrodenetleyiciler, zamanlayıcı projeleri için mükemmel bir seçimdir. Bu mikrodenetleyiciler, esnekliği ve programlanabilirliği sayesinde birçok farklı uygulamada kullanılabilir. Özellikle, Entegre Dünyası markasının sunduğu çözümlerle, bu projeleri daha da kolay hale getirebilirsiniz. Zamanlayıcı projeleri, günlük yaşamda sıkça karşılaştığımız uygulamalardan biridir; örneğin, otomatik ışık açma-kapama sistemleri veya sulama sistemleri gibi. Bu makalede, PIC12 mikrodenetleyicilerin nasıl kullanılacağını ve bu projelerin nasıl geliştirileceğini keşfedeceğiz.
Zamanlayıcı projeleri için bazı temel bileşenler gereklidir. Bunlar arasında rezistörler, kondansatörler ve butonlar yer alır. Bu bileşenlerin her biri, projenin işlevselliğini artırmak için kritik rol oynar. Örneğin, bir kondansatör, belirli bir süre boyunca enerji depolayarak zamanlama işlevini yerine getirir. PIC12 mikrodenetleyici ile birlikte kullanıldığında, bu bileşenler, karmaşık zamanlama görevlerini bile kolayca yönetebilir. Şimdi, bu bileşenlerin nasıl bir araya getirileceğine bakalım.
PIC12 mikrodenetleyicinin programlanması, ilk bakışta karmaşık görünebilir, ancak doğru teknikler ve yazılım araçları ile bu süreç oldukça basit hale gelir. Örneğin, Microchip MPLAB IDE gibi yazılımlar, kullanıcı dostu arayüzleri sayesinde programlama sürecini kolaylaştırır. Programlama adımlarını takip ederek, zamanlayıcı projelerinizi hızlı bir şekilde hayata geçirebilirsiniz. Unutmayın, her projenin kendine özgü gereksinimleri vardır, bu yüzden her zaman projenizin ihtiyaçlarına uygun bir yaklaşım benimsemelisiniz.
Zamanlayıcı Projeleri için Gerekli Bileşenler
Zamanlayıcı projeleri oluştururken, doğru bileşenleri seçmek oldukça önemlidir. Bu projelerde, mikrodenetleyici en kritik parçadır. PIC12 serisi, düşük enerji tüketimi ve yüksek performansı ile bu tür projeler için ideal bir seçimdir. Ancak, sadece mikrodenetleyici yeterli değildir. Ayrıca, giriş/çıkış (I/O) portları, rezistörler, kondansatörler ve LED'ler gibi diğer bileşenler de gereklidir.
Örneğin, bir zamanlayıcı projesi için aşağıdaki bileşenleri kullanabilirsiniz:
- Mikrodenetleyici: PIC12 serisi
- Rele: Zamanlayıcı işlevini gerçekleştirmek için
- LED: Durum göstergesi olarak
- Rezistör: LED'in akımını sınırlamak için
Bu bileşenlerin her biri, projenizin işlevselliğini artırır. Örneğin, Entegre Dünyası markası, yüksek kaliteli bileşenleri ile bilinir ve projelerinizde güvenilirlik sağlar. Bu nedenle, projelerinizde Entegre Dünyası ürünlerini tercih ederek, başarı şansınızı artırabilirsiniz.
Sonuç olarak, zamanlayıcı projeleri için gerekli olan bileşenleri doğru seçmek, projenizin başarısını doğrudan etkiler. Bu bileşenlerin bir araya getirilmesi ve doğru bir şekilde programlanması, hayalinizdeki projeyi gerçeğe dönüştürmenizde size yardımcı olacaktır.
PIC12 Mikrodenetleyici Programlama Teknikleri
PIC12 mikrodenetleyicileri programlamak, elektronik projelerin kalbinde yer alır. Entegre Dünyası gibi güvenilir bir markanın sunduğu araçlar sayesinde, bu süreç hem kolay hem de eğlenceli hale gelir. İlk adım olarak, geliştirme ortamı seçimi oldukça önemlidir. Genellikle, MPLAB X IDE ya da mikrodenetleyiciye uygun diğer yazılımlar tercih edilir. Bu yazılımlar, kullanıcı dostu arayüzleriyle programlama sürecini hızlandırır.
Programlama sırasında, Assembly veya C dili gibi diller kullanılabilir. Her dilin kendine özgü avantajları vardır. Örneğin, Assembly dili düşük seviyeli kontrol sağlar, ancak C dili daha okunabilir ve yazımı daha kolaydır. Hangi dili seçeceğinize karar verirken, projenizin karmaşıklığını ve gereksinimlerini göz önünde bulundurmalısınız.
Ayrıca, debugging süreci de oldukça önemlidir. Hataları bulmak ve düzeltmek için simülatörler ya da gerçek zamanlı izleme araçları kullanabilirsiniz. Bu noktada, Entegre Dünyası ürünleri, kullanıcıların hata ayıklama işlemlerini daha verimli bir şekilde gerçekleştirmelerine olanak tanır. Unutmayın, programlamada deneyim kazanmak zaman alır, ama doğru araçlarla bu süreci hızlandırmak mümkündür.
Sıkça Sorulan Sorular
- PIC12 mikrodenetleyici nedir?
PIC12 mikrodenetleyici, düşük güç tüketimi ve yüksek performans sunan, genellikle basit kontrol uygulamaları için kullanılan bir entegre devre (IC) modelidir. Zamanlayıcı projeleri için ideal bir seçimdir.
- Zamanlayıcı projeleri için hangi bileşenler gereklidir?
Zamanlayıcı projeleri oluşturmak için genellikle bir PIC12 mikrodenetleyici, dirençler, kapasitörler, bir kristal osilatör ve gerekli bağlantı elemanları gereklidir. Bu bileşenler bir araya gelerek işlevsel bir devre oluşturur.
- PIC12 mikrodenetleyiciyi nasıl programlayabilirim?
PIC12 mikrodenetleyiciyi programlamak için genellikle MPLAB IDE gibi yazılımlar kullanılır. Bu yazılımlar ile kod yazabilir, derleyebilir ve mikrodenetleyiciye yükleyebilirsiniz. Uygulamalı örneklerle bu süreci daha iyi anlayabilirsiniz.